FROM FABRIC TO JEANS (OUR MANUFACTURING PROCESS)
1) COTTON TO FIBER PREPARATION
- Ginning & Cleaning: Removes seeds/plant matter.
- Carding: Aligns fibers into a sliver.
- Combing (optional): Removes short fibers for stronger yarn.
2) SPINNING THE YARN
- Drawing: Blends slivers to even mass.
- Roving: Adds light twist.
- Spinning: Final twist (ring-spun or OE) sets strength/hand-feel.
3) INDIGO DYEING (ROPE OR SLASH)
Indigo dyeing relies on repeated dip–air cycles (indigoxidation) to build color.
Callout: Indigo lives on the surface → that's why jeans have a classic fade.
4) WEAVING THE DENIM
- Twill structure (3/1 or 2/1) creates diagonal lines.
- Indigo-dyed warp with undyed weft.
- Stretch blends (elastane/T400) add recovery and comfort for ladies bottomwear.
5) FINISHING THE GREIGE FABRIC
- Singeing & desizing smooth the surface.
- Sanforization pre-shrinks fabric.
- Skewing prevents leg twist after wash.
Callout: Sanforized fabric = less shrinkage for your customers.
6) PATTERN MAKING & CUTTING
- Fit-first patterns with consistent grading.
- Marker efficiency optimizes material use.
- Calibrated cutting for precision.
7) STITCHING & ASSEMBLY
- Key ops: fly, pockets, yoke, inseam, outseam, waistband, hem.
- Reinforcements at stress areas, consistent SPI, durable threads.
8) WASHING & EFFECTS
- Enzyme & stone for hand-feel and character.
- Whisker effects add high–low contrast.
- Shrinkage control via lab-tested recipes.

CARE & LONGEVITY TIPS
- Wash cold and inside-out to preserve indigo dyeing.
- Avoid harsh detergents; line dry to reduce wear.
- Rotate pairs to maintain recovery and shape.
